Description
From the Cancer Moonshot to the Grand Cancer Challenge, there’s palpable urgency to advance cutting edge technologies out of academic labs that can treat and prevent cancer.
Are you looking for a company partner to advance a new oncology target, compound, or biomarker? At AUTM’s Oncology Partnering Forum, leading oncology companies share valuable intel on their:
-
Oncology discovery pipeline
-
Current scouting priorities in oncology for collaboration or licensing with academic partners
-
Preferred format, content and process for vetting academic technologies
Meet company reps from Astellas Pharma, ElevateBio, AbbVie, Johnson & Johnson Innovations, and Qualigen Therapeutics. The Partnering Forum will open with a presentation about the Cancer Grand Challenge by program managers from the National Cancer Institute and Cancer Research UK. Learn more about this trans-Atlantic collaborative funding opportunity, and its unique intellectual property ownership and licensing structures. The forum also includes a panel discussion on “Partnering in the Crowded Immuno-Oncology Landscape” with key opinion leaders from venture, industry and philanthropy.
